Design and Build

Garmin Forerunner 45

The Garmin Forerunner 45 boasts a sleek and sporty design, featuring a circular face with a 1.04-inch color LCD display and a resolution of 208 x 208 pixels. Weighing in at a light 32 grams, its build comprises of sturdy materials that are comfortable to wear during workouts.

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ro

On the other hand, the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ro showcases a modern and stylish look with its curved 1.5-inch AMOLED color screen, offering a better resolution at 216 x 432 pixels. The device is slightly heavier at 33 grams due to its more robust construction and added features.

Comparison of design and build quality

While both devices have a similar water resistance of 5 ATM, the Gear Fit2 Pro offers a better display quality with its AMOLED screen. The Forerunner 45, however, offers a sportier design and is slightly lighter than its counterpart. The choice between the two depends on the user’s preference for appearance and comfort.

Features and Functionality

Garmin Forerunner 45

Operating on a built-in system, the Forerunner 45 offers essential fitness tracking like calories, cycling, distance, heart rate, sleep, steps, and swimming, along with additional features such as an accelerometer, barometer, GPS, Bluetooth, and Wi-Fi. The device lacks NFC and voice function capabilities but compensates with a longer battery life of up to 7 days.

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ro

Powered by Tizen OS, the Gear Fit2 Pro also tracks calories, cycling, distance, heart rate, steps, and swimming, but misses out on sleep tracking. With features like accelerometer, barometer, GPS, Bluetooth, and Wi-Fi, the device also includes NFC, though it lacks an audio speaker and voice function. Its battery life is shorter at only 2 days.

Comparison of features and performance

While both devices offer a comprehensive set of fitness tracking features, the Forerunner 45 has an advantage in battery life, making it more suitable for extended use without frequent charging. Compatibility with Android and iOS is available for both devices, while the Gear Fit2 Pro has extra functionality with its NFC feature.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does the Garmin Forerunner 45 have sleep tracking?

Yes, the Garmin Forerunner 45 does feature sleep tracking capabilities.

Is the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ro compatible with iPhones?

Yes, the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ro is compatible with both Android and iOS devices.

Which has a longer battery life, the Garmin Forerunner 45 or the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ro?

The Garmin Forerunner 45 has a significantly longer battery life of up to 7 days, compared to the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ro, which lasts only up to 2 days.

Are both devices water-resistant?

Yes, both the Garmin Forerunner 45 and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ro have a water resistance rating of 5 ATM, suitable for swimming and water-based activities.

Do both smartwatches have GPS?

Yes, both the Garmin Forerunner 45 and Samsung Gear Fit2 Pro are equipped with GPS functionality.
